Configuring DHCP Relay

First, you must configure your PCs to accept DHCP information assigned by a DHCP server:

1.Open the Windows [Control Panel] and display the computer's [Networking properties]. Configure the TCP/IP properties

to [Obtain an IP address automatically] (the actual text may vary depending on your operating system). For detailed instructions, see Quick Start, Configuring Your Computers on page 9 Next, specify the IP address of the DHCP server and select the interfaces on your network that will be using the relay service.

2.Log into the Configuration Manager, click the [LAN] tab. Then click [DHCP Relay] in the task bar. The [Dynamic Host Configuration Protocol (DHCP) Relay Configuration] page appears:

Figure 14. Dynamic Host Configuration Protocol (DHCP)

Relay Configuration Page

3.In the [DHCP Server Address] fields, type the IP address

of your ISP's DHCP server. If you do not have this number, it is not essential to enter it here. Requests for IP information from your LAN will be passed to the default gateway, which should route the request appropriately.
